
From the first time Alan danced on stage in kindergarten, he knew he wanted to be a performer. He started playing guitar at 13 and began writing and performing his songs in clubs during his years at East Carolina University.
He’s lived and performed in many different cities in the eastern US and settled in Nashville TN in the late nineties where he fell in with a group of amazing, inspiring singer/songwriters. It was in this creative environment that he wrote the songs he’s most proud of!

Midnight came out of a song writing exercise called “Title of the Month.“ We would choose a title among the group and then play our various songs at the next writers night. “Midnight “ was one of those titles and the minute I heard it I knew the story I wanted to tell.
I came to ECU in the early 70’s to study theatre and dance and was fortunate enough to study ballet and jazz with the renowned dancer, Mavis Ray. I danced semi professionally for a time in the late 70’s and early 80’s.
